Ubuntu系统根目录扩容的两种方式(附图文讲解)
<div id="navCategory"><h5 class="catalogue">目录</h5><ul class="first_class_ul"><li>前言</li><li>扩容前准备:</li><li>一、使用GParted工具给Ubuntu系统扩容(适用于桌面版)<ul class="second_class_ul"><li>1.安装GParted工具,并运行</li><li>2.使用GParted调整扩容分区大小</li></ul></li><li>二、使用Parted工具给Ubuntu系统扩容(适用于Server版)<ul class="second_class_ul"><li>1.查看目前根目录大小和分区状况</li><li>2.使用Parted命令调整扩容根分区大小</li></ul></li><li>总结<ul class="second_class_ul"></ul></li><li>VMware虚拟机Ubuntu磁盘扩容<ul class="second_class_ul"><li>VMware中操作:</li><li>然后我们进到虚拟机里面</li></ul></li></ul></div><p class="maodian"></p><h2>前言</h2><p>本文主要是在虚拟机环境进行的Ubuntu系统扩容测试,主要测试GParted和Parted两种方式,GParted主要是在带GUI界面的Ubuntu系统中使用,Parted主要是在Server版Ubuntu系统中使用,此外实际操作中建议先备份系统数据后再扩容,以防重要数据受损。</p>
<p class="maodian"></p><h2>扩容前准备:</h2>
<p>准备已安装的Ubuntu虚拟机,测试虚拟机根分区扩容前大小为为60G,现准备扩容20G,使根分区大小扩容到80G</p>
<p><strong>扩容前</strong>:</p>
<p style="text-align:center"><img style="max-width:100%!important;height:auto!important;"alt="" src="https://zhuji.jb51.net/uploads/allimg/20250606/2-250606115Z3263.png" /></p>
<p><strong>扩容后</strong>:</p>
<p>点击编辑虚拟机设置,弹出窗口选择硬盘选项,点击扩展,弹出窗口输入将最大磁盘大小改为80,点击扩展-确定, 然后开启此虚拟机开始扩容。</p>
<p style="text-align:center"><img style="max-width:100%!important;height:auto!important;"alt="" src="https://zhuji.jb51.net/uploads/allimg/20250606/2-250606115Z4N7.png" /></p>
<p class="maodian"></p><h2>一、使用GParted工具给Ubuntu系统扩容(适用于桌面版)</h2>
<p class="maodian"></p><h3>1.安装GParted工具,并运行</h3>
<div class="dxycode"><pre class="brush:bash;">#apt install gparted -y (在root账户下进行的安装,使用管理员用户命令前加sudo)
#gparted (安装完成输入gparted命令,点击enter运行gparted,也可以在应用程序里找到gparted图标点击运行)</pre></div>
<p style="text-align:center"><img style="max-width:100%!important;height:auto!important;"alt="" src="https://zhuji.jb51.net/uploads/allimg/20250606/2-250606115Z4C5.png" /></p>
<p class="maodian"></p><h3>2.使用GParted调整扩容分区大小</h3>
<p>1.运行GParted后弹出操作图形窗口,选择根目录的上级目录,我这里是/dev/sda2,然后点击选择调整大小/移动,弹出窗口可以手动拖动,也可以将之后可用空间设置为0即可,然后点击调整大小,这样未分配的空间就调整到根目录的主分区下。</p>
<p style="text-align:center"><img style="max-width:100%!important;height:auto!important;"alt="" src="https://zhuji.jb51.net/uploads/allimg/20250606/2-250606115Z4115.png" /></p>
<p style="text-align:center"><img style="max-width:100%!important;height:auto!important;"alt="" src="https://zhuji.jb51.net/uploads/allimg/20250606/2-250606115Z4M1.png" /></p>
<p>2.然后选择根分区/dev/sda5,选择调整大小,可以手动拖动,也可以将之后可用空间设置为0即可,然后点击调整大小,然后点击”对号“应用全部操作</p>
<p style="text-align:center"><img style="max-width:100%!important;height:auto!important;"alt="" src="https://zhuji.jb51.net/uploads/allimg/20250606/2-250606115Z52C.png" /></p>
<p style="text-align:center"><img style="max-width:100%!important;height:auto!important;"alt="" src="https://zhuji.jb51.net/uploads/allimg/20250606/2-250606115Z5E9.png" /></p>
<p>按照以上步骤即完成了对根目录大小的扩容。</p>
<p class="maodian"></p><h2>二、使用Parted工具给Ubuntu系统扩容(适用于Server版)</h2>
<p class="maodian"></p><h3>1.查看目前根目录大小和分区状况</h3>
<div class="dxycode"><pre class="brush:bash;">#df -h (查看目前根分区目录大小)
#lsblk (查看分区状况)</pre></div>
<p style="text-align:center"><img style="max-width:100%!important;height:auto!important;"alt="" src="https://zhuji.jb51.net/uploads/allimg/20250606/2-250606115Z5I9.png" /></p>
<p class="maodian"></p><h3>2.使用Parted命令调整扩容根分区大小</h3>
<div class="dxycode"><pre class="brush:bash;">#parted /dev/sda (使用parted操作/dev/sda分区)
(parted)print (显示当前分区状况,记住sda大小)
(parted)help (help命令可以查看命令列表,可以用该命令)
使用命令:resizeparted NUMBEREND,其中NUMBER是分区号,END是指需要扩容到多少
(parted)resizepart 2 85.9GB (首先将空闲空间划分到根目录的主目录,我这里是/dev/sda2,然后才能将空闲空间划分给根目录)
(parted)yes
(parted)85.9GB
(parted)resizepart 5 85.9GB (将空闲空间划分到根目录,我这里是/dev/sda5)
(parted)yes
(parted)85.9GB
(parted)quit
#resize2fs /dev/sda5 (使用resize2fs命令调整磁盘大小)
#lsblk (使用lsblk命令再次查看/dev/sda5根目录大小发现已完成调)</pre></div>
<p style="text-align:center"><img style="max-width:100%!important;height:auto!important;"alt="" src="https://zhuji.jb51.net/uploads/allimg/20250606/2-250606115ZA53.png" /></p>
<p style="text-align:center"><img style="max-width:100%!important;height:auto!important;"alt="" src="https://zhuji.jb51.net/uploads/allimg/20250606/2-250606115ZG16.png" /></p>
<p>以上完成对根目录的扩容调整。</p>
<p class="maodian"></p><h2>总结</h2>
<p>以上主要是通过gparted图形工具对Ubuntu系统根目录进行扩容和使用parted命令对Ubuntu系统根目录进行扩容调整,可以根据实际情况参考使用,特别提示:扩容需谨慎,使用工作使用,一定要提前备份好数据。</p>
<p class="maodian"></p><h2>VMware虚拟机Ubuntu磁盘扩容</h2>
<p class="maodian"></p><h3>VMware中操作:</h3>
<p>选择要扩容的虚拟机,点击编辑虚拟机设置</p>
<p style="text-align:center"><img style="max-width:100%!important;height:auto!important;"alt="" src="https://zhuji.jb51.net/uploads/allimg/20250606/2-250606115ZM08.png" /></p>
<p>打开后点击磁盘——>点击扩展(注意:如果想要扩容的话需要删除快照)</p>
<p style="text-align:center"><img style="max-width:100%!important;height:auto!important;"alt="" src="https://zhuji.jb51.net/uploads/allimg/20250606/2-250606115ZTb.png" /></p>
<p>调整到你想要的容量</p>
<p>点击上图的扩展——>确定</p>
<p class="maodian"></p><h3>然后我们进到虚拟机里面</h3>
<p>首先,我们Ctrl+Alt+T打开终端</p>
<p>然后sudo apt-get install gparted——安装工具</p>
<p style="text-align:center"><img style="max-width:100%!important;height:auto!important;"alt="" src="https://zhuji.jb51.net/uploads/allimg/20250606/2-250606115ZR61.png" /></p>
<p>然后输入sudo gparted打开:</p>
<p style="text-align:center"><img style="max-width:100%!important;height:auto!important;"alt="" src="https://zhuji.jb51.net/uploads/allimg/20250606/2-250606115Z9607.png" /></p>
<p>输入你当前的密码</p>
<p>会进入到类似这个界面(每个人的电脑不一样,我这个根目录再sda5中,sda5又在sha2下,所以我要先挂2再挂5)</p>
<p style="text-align:center"><img style="max-width:100%!important;height:auto!important;"alt="" src="https://zhuji.jb51.net/uploads/allimg/20250606/2-250606115910146.png" /></p>
<p>可以看到我们有20G的未分配空间,要求要挂载到/dev/sda5上</p>
<p>我们可以先挂到/dev/sda2上</p>
<p>操作为:点击需挂载的磁盘,然后点击向左图标</p>
<p style="text-align:center"><img style="max-width:100%!important;height:auto!important;"alt="" src="https://zhuji.jb51.net/uploads/allimg/20250606/2-250606115911531.png" /></p>
<p>我们把它拉满(即之前/之后可用空间都为0),然后点击下方调整大小</p>
<p>同样的操作对/dev/sda5再进行一次</p>
<p style="text-align:center"><img style="max-width:100%!important;height:auto!important;"alt="" src="https://zhuji.jb51.net/uploads/allimg/20250606/2-250606115911219.png" /></p>
<p>点击</p>
<p style="text-align:center"><img style="max-width:100%!important;height:auto!important;"alt="" src="https://zhuji.jb51.net/uploads/allimg/20250606/2-250606115911O8.png" /></p>
<p>即可</p>
<p style="text-align:center"><img style="max-width:100%!important;height:auto!important;"alt="" src="https://zhuji.jb51.net/uploads/allimg/20250606/2-2506061159122a.png" /></p>
<p>成功扩容</p>
<p>以上就是Ubuntu根分区扩容两种方式的详细内容,更多相关资料请阅读琼殿技术社区其它文章!</p>
頁:
[1]